Night vision devices come in different types. Probably the most well-known is the night vision monocular, which is the single-eye version of the binoculars. As opposed to having two lenses, a monocular only has one. Since it is only half the structure of the binocular, it’s smaller, lighter, and less complicated to carry, making it a common choice among people on the go. Like night vision binoculars, the monocular also has a number of purposes which includes surveillance, hunting, bird watching, and so on. Discover how the monocular works

Just before you set out to purchase this device, you must first find out some facts about it. Don't forget, a superb option is an informed option. Understanding how night vision monoculars function will enable you to come across the most beneficial device accessible in the market. A monocular works by magnifying an object which you wish to look at. Initially, the light that bounces off the object enters the monocular’s objective lens. Then the lens would bend the light. The light that comes in at the top of the objective lens is bent downwards. The light at the bottom is bent upwards. This causes the image to reverse or flip upside down. The eyepieces lens is the second lens where the light passes once again so that the image is going to be flipped to the right side before hitting the eye. This is why you see the correct image if you look in the monocular.

Take into consideration the lens’ magnificatio

Probably the most vital qualities with the monocular is magnification. This really is typically indicated by the initial number of the instrument’s optical specification. For example, if you see 5 x 10 in a device, then the 5 refers to the magnification number which refers to the number of times an object would appear larger under the monocular. Based on your activity or objective, pick the appropriate number of magnification. While smaller magnification could be suffice for recreational activities, surveillance and military operations would of course call for a higher number.

Pick the objective size

Next, you need to choose the proper objective size. This refers to the second number in the optical specification. Like in 5 x 10, the 10 is the objective size, which is basically the size of the front lens in millimeters. The greater the objective size is, the heavier the monocular could be. That's why, you should also check this number before you make a purchase.
